What Is IoT in Warehousing?

IoT in warehousing refers to the use of internet-connected devices such as sensors, cameras, RFID tags, and smart equipment to collect and exchange data across warehouse operations. These devices communicate continuously, providing real-time insights into inventory movement, equipment health, environmental conditions, and workforce activity.

Unlike traditional systems that rely heavily on manual inputs and periodic checks, IoT creates a living, data-driven warehouse ecosystem. This foundation allows businesses to automate decisions, reduce delays, and optimize workflows without human intervention at every step.

Why Warehousing Needs Smart Automation Today

Modern warehouses face several operational challenges:

  • Inaccurate inventory records
  • Delays in picking and dispatch
  • Equipment downtime
  • Safety risks and human errors
  • Rising operational costs

Manual processes simply cannot keep up with the scale and speed required today. Smart warehouse automation powered by IoT addresses these issues by enabling continuous monitoring and intelligent response mechanisms. With connected systems in place, warehouse managers can shift from reactive problem-solving to proactive optimization.

Key Components of IoT-Enabled Warehouses

Industrial IoT Sensors

Industrial IoT sensors form the backbone of connected warehouses. These sensors track temperature, humidity, motion, vibration, and location. In sensitive storage environments such as pharmaceuticals or food warehouses, sensors ensure compliance by alerting teams instantly when conditions fall outside acceptable limits.

Connected Warehouse Systems

Connected warehouse systems integrate IoT devices with warehouse management software (WMS), ERP platforms, and analytics dashboards. This integration ensures seamless data flow across departments, enabling faster and more accurate decision-making.

Real-Time Data Networks

High-speed connectivity allows data collected by IoT devices to be transmitted and analyzed instantly. This real-time visibility enables faster responses to inventory shortages, bottlenecks, or equipment failures.

How IoT Improves Warehouse Operations

Real-Time Inventory Tracking

One of the biggest advantages of IoT is real-time inventory tracking. RFID tags, smart shelves, and location sensors automatically update inventory levels as goods move in and out of the warehouse.

This eliminates manual stock counts, reduces discrepancies, and ensures that inventory data is always accurate. Businesses can fulfill orders faster and avoid costly overstocking or stockouts.

Faster Order Picking and Fulfillment

IoT-enabled picking systems guide warehouse staff through optimized routes, reducing travel time within large facilities. Automated alerts direct workers to the exact item location, improving picking speed and accuracy.

As a result, order processing times decrease significantly, leading to faster dispatch and improved customer satisfaction.

Predictive Maintenance in Warehouses

Unplanned equipment downtime can disrupt entire operations. Predictive maintenance in warehouses uses sensor data to monitor equipment health continuously.

By analyzing vibration, temperature, and usage patterns, IoT systems can predict failures before they happen. Maintenance teams receive alerts in advance, allowing repairs to be scheduled without halting operations.

Improved Safety and Compliance

IoT enhances warehouse safety by monitoring restricted zones, equipment usage, and environmental conditions. Smart alerts notify managers about unsafe behaviors, unauthorized access, or hazardous conditions in real time.

This not only protects workers but also helps warehouses maintain regulatory compliance.

Smart Warehouse Automation in Action

Smart warehouse automation combines IoT with AI-driven analytics and automation tools. For example:

  • Automated conveyor systems adjust speeds based on real-time load
  • Smart lighting turns on only in occupied zones
  • Autonomous mobile robots navigate dynamically using sensor data

These capabilities reduce energy consumption, improve throughput, and lower operational costs.

IoT in warehousing for real-time tracking and automated operations
IoT in warehousing for real-time tracking and automated operations

Benefits of Warehouse IoT Solutions

Higher Operational Efficiency

Warehouse IoT solutions streamline processes by eliminating manual data entry and repetitive tasks. Automated data collection improves accuracy and allows staff to focus on higher-value activities.

Cost Reduction

By optimizing energy usage, preventing equipment failures, and reducing inventory waste, IoT helps warehouses lower operational expenses significantly.

Scalability and Flexibility

IoT systems scale easily as warehouse operations grow. New devices and sensors can be added without redesigning existing infrastructure, making IoT ideal for expanding businesses.

Data-Driven Decision Making

With continuous data flow from connected devices, warehouse managers gain actionable insights into performance trends, bottlenecks, and improvement areas.

Challenges in Implementing IoT in Warehousing

While IoT in warehousing offers immense value, implementation comes with challenges:

  • Integration with legacy systems
  • Data security and privacy concerns
  • Initial investment costs
  • Workforce training requirements

However, with the right technology partner and a phased implementation approach, these challenges can be addressed effectively.

Future of IoT-Driven Warehouses

The future of warehousing lies in hyper-automation and intelligence. As IoT integrates further with AI, machine learning, and computer vision, warehouses will become increasingly autonomous.

Advanced analytics will enable self-optimizing workflows, while AI-powered video intelligence will enhance security, productivity monitoring, and safety compliance.
